Artist Biography
Available in: gb icon
Company of Thieves is an indie rock group from Chicago, Illinois. The band was founded by current members Genevieve Schatz (vocals) and Marc Walloch (guitar). Their first release, Ordinary Riches, was released digitally on January 6, 2009, with a physical CD release on February 24, 2009. Company of Thieves is signed to Wind-up Records.

They have been featured as an iTunes Discovery Download for their song "Oscar Wilde",as well as in their Indie Spotlight: Rock/Alternative – featuring the album alongside the recommended track, "Pressure".
The band's debut album Ordinary Riches debuted on Billboard's Heatseekers Chart at No. 5.They also won the 2007 New York Songwriters Circle contest for their song, "Oscar Wilde".
In January 2009, Genevieve and Marc appeared on "Live From Daryl's House",Daryl Hall's monthly Internet concert, as Company of Thieves. They performed "Pressure", "Even In The Dark", "Past the Sleep" and "Around The Block" from their debut album, along with Hall & Oates songs "Starting All Over Again" and "Everytime You Go Away", as well as other covers. They also performed on Last Call with Carson Daly in February.

Company of Thieves' single "Oscar Wilde" was featured on "Gossip Girl: Real NY Stories Revealed" as part of the Dove Go Fresh campaign,as well as being aired during an episode of Gossip Girl.

Their second album, Running from a Gamble, was released on May 17, 2011. The lead-off single, "Death of Communication", was released on March 15, 2011.
The band has gone through several line-up changes since their debut album. They began as a trio with founding members Genevieve Schatz and Marc Walloch alongside drummer Mike Ortiz. In 2011 Ortiz posted a formal letter to his fans on the official website of Company of Thieves stating his decision to depart from the band. Ortiz's drumming was a distinguishing factor of the band's sound along with the unique guitar chords of Marc over the soothing sound of singer Genevieve's voice. Chris Faller (former bassist of The Hush Sound) was used as bassist on Company of Thieves' latest album, "Running from a Gamble". Faller played drums for the band's live performances after Mike Ortiz left along with bassist Marcin Sulewski. On their latest tour in 2012, Company of Thieves has appeared with Chris Faller as bassist on stage along with a new drummer. Eitan Bernstein did not play keyboards on the second album, but now tours with the band as the official keyboardist.
